안녕하세요.
ABAP을 1개월 독학중인 초보입니다.
BDC프로그램을 만들고있는데, 문제가 생겼습니다.
'활성/비활성', '활성일자', '비활성일자' 이렇게 세 필드가 있습니다.
각각 ACTV / ACTV_Y / ACTV_N 라고할때
ACTV에는 Y / N 값만 넣을 수 있고,
ACTV_Y 와 ACTV_N 은 ACTV값에 따라 활성화됐다가 바활성화됐다가 합니다.
현재 값을 ACTV에 Y값이라 ACTV_Y가 활성화되어 값이 들어가있는 상태입니다.
여기서 레코딩을 따라 BDC로 ACTV값을 N으로 바꾸고 =/00값을 주면 ACTV_N이 활성화될거라 생각했는데
활성화가 되지않아 여기에 값을 넣으려고하면 값을 넣을 수 없다고 계속 오류가 뜹니다 ㅠ
현재 이렇게 짜서 실행하고있는데.. ACTV필드를 Y를 넣고 엔터명령을 보내봐도 활성일자가 활성화가 안돼서 입력필드가 아니라는 오류가 뜹니다.
해결 방법이 있을까요? ㅠㅠ 도움 부탁드립니다.
해결했습니다.
ACTV 에 값을 넣은 다음에 화면명을 다시 한번 넣어주니 해결되네요..
읽어주신분들 감사합니다.